加入收藏 | 设为首页 | 会员中心 | 我要投稿 我爱制作网_池州站长网 (https://www.0566zz.com/)- 数据快递、应用安全、业务安全、智能内容、文字识别!
当前位置: 首页 > 站长学院 > MySql教程 > 正文

MySQL优化秘籍:DBA高效管理数据库的实战之道

发布时间:2025-11-08 14:23:01 所属栏目:MySql教程 来源:DaWei
导读: MySQL优化是数据库管理员(DBA)日常工作中不可或缺的一部分。高效的数据库管理不仅能提升系统性能,还能减少资源消耗,确保业务稳定运行。 选择合适的存储引擎是优化的第一步。InnoDB支持事务和行级锁,适合

MySQL优化是数据库管理员(DBA)日常工作中不可或缺的一部分。高效的数据库管理不仅能提升系统性能,还能减少资源消耗,确保业务稳定运行。


选择合适的存储引擎是优化的第一步。InnoDB支持事务和行级锁,适合大多数应用场景;而MyISAM在读多写少的场景下可能更高效,但缺乏事务支持。


索引是提升查询速度的关键工具。合理创建索引可以大幅减少数据扫描量,但过多的索引会影响写入性能。应根据查询条件和频率来设计索引。


查询语句的优化同样重要。避免使用SELECT ,尽量只获取需要的数据;合理使用JOIN操作,减少子查询的嵌套层级,有助于提高执行效率。


数据库结构设计直接影响性能。规范的表结构、合理的字段类型选择以及范式化或反范式化的权衡,都是DBA需要关注的重点。


定期监控和分析慢查询日志,能够帮助发现潜在的性能瓶颈。结合EXPLAIN命令分析查询计划,是排查问题的有效手段。


保持对MySQL版本的更新和配置参数的调整,也是持续优化的重要环节。不同业务场景下,配置参数的最优值可能有所不同。

(编辑:我爱制作网_池州站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章